Golden, comforting, and incredibly satisfying, this truly best Spanish omelette recipe (tortilla española) is a classic recipe made with just five everyday ingredients. Perfect for breakfast, lunch, dinner, or snacks, it’s a dish that’s stood the test of time in Spanish kitchens — and for good reason.

Why You’ll Love This Recipe

Simple & Budget-Friendly: Only potatoes, eggs, onion, oil, and seasoning.

Versatile: Serve warm, room temp, or cold; enjoy as a meal or snack.

Impressive but Easy: Looks fancy, but is surprisingly simple to make.

Make-Ahead Friendly: Stays delicious for up to two days in the fridge.

Spanish omelette recipe slice lifted from a plate, showing golden crust and potato layers

Ingredients You’ll Need

Potatoes (4 small to medium) — peeled, thinly sliced

Onion (1 large) — chopped

Green Bell Pepper (1 small, optional) — for extra flavor and color

Eggs (4–5 large)

Olive Oil (¼ cup, plus extra) — for cooking and richness

Salt & Pepper — essential seasoning

Smoked Cayenne Powder (¼ tsp, optional) — adds subtle smoky heat

How to Make Spanish Omelette (Step by Step)

1️⃣ Prep the veggies: Peel and thinly slice the potatoes. Toss them with salt. Chop the onion and green bell pepper.

2️⃣ Cook the potatoes and onions: Heat olive oil in a pan over medium-high heat. Add potatoes and cook for 1–2 minutes. Reduce heat to low, cover, and cook for 15–20 minutes, stirring occasionally, until tender.

3️⃣ Whisk the eggs: In a large bowl, beat the eggs with salt, pepper, and optional cayenne.

4️⃣ Combine: Let the cooked potato mixture cool slightly, then gently fold into the eggs.

5️⃣ Cook the omelette: Heat extra oil in a smaller pan over medium heat. Pour in the egg mixture, let it cook 1–2 minutes, then lower heat and cook uncovered for 8–10 minutes until two-thirds set.

6️⃣ Flip: Place a plate over the pan, flip the omelette onto it, then slide it back into the pan to cook the other side for 5 minutes.

7️⃣ Serve: Slide onto a plate or board. Slice into wedges and serve!

How to Serve Spanish Omelette

With a my Favorite Tomato Salad recipe.

Alongside crusty bread and a drizzle of olive oil.

As part of a tapas spread with olives, cheese, and cured meats.

Cold or room temperature in lunchboxes or picnics.

Topped with a dollop of aioli or garlic mayo for extra richness.

Why This Recipe Works

The key to this Spanish omelette is the slow-cooked, tender potatoes combined with well-seasoned, fluffy eggs. Cooking slowly prevents browning and keeps the interior soft. Flipping ensures both sides cook evenly, creating a golden crust while the inside stays custardy and creamy.

Spanish omelette recipe slice lifted from a plate, showing golden crust and potato layers

The Best Spanish Omelette Recipe

This classic Spanish omelette is made with just potatoes, eggs, onions, and olive oil. It’s a rustic, comforting dish that’s perfect for any time of day and comes together with simple, pantry-friendly ingredients. Whether you’re making it for a family meal or slicing it up for a picnic, this recipe delivers reliable, delicious results every time.
No ratings yet
Print Pin Rate
Course: Breakfast, Lunch
Cuisine: European, Spanish
Keyword: authentic spanish recipes, classic spanish recipe, comfort food, comfort food Spain, easy spanish omelette, homemade tortilla, how to flip tortilla, olive oil egg recipes, potato and egg recipes, spanish cooking, spanish omelette, spanish potato omelette, tapas recipe, tortilla espanola, traditional spanish food, vegetarian spanish dish
Servings: 5 servings
Author: Linas “MadBake” Marlowe

Ingredients

  • 4 small to medium potatoes, peeled and thinly sliced
  • 1 large onion, chopped
  • 1 small green bell pepper, chopped (optional)
  • 4 to 5 large eggs
  • ¼ tsp smoked cayenne pepper powder (optional)
  • ¼ cup (60 ml) olive oil or vegetable oil, plus extra for frying
  • Salt and pepper, to taste

Instructions

  • Cook potatoes, onion, and pepper in olive oil over low heat, covered, 15–20 min.
  • Whisk eggs with salt, pepper, cayenne. Fold into cooled potatoes.
  • Pour into pan, cook low 8–10 min until set.
  • Flip onto plate, return to pan, cook another 5 min.
  • Slice and serve!

Video

Expert Tips for Success

Use the right potatoes: Waxy potatoes (like Yukon Gold) hold their shape best.

Low and slow: Cook the potatoes over gentle heat for a creamy texture.

Confident flipping: Use a plate slightly larger than your pan and flip firmly but carefully.

Rest before slicing: Let the omelette sit for 5–10 minutes after cooking for easier slicing and better texture.

Frequently Asked Questions (FAQ)

Can I make Spanish omelette ahead of time? Yes! It tastes great cold or at room temperature and keeps in the fridge for up to 2 days.

Do I have to use onions and peppers? Traditional Spanish omelettes use just potatoes and eggs, but onions and peppers add extra flavor and sweetness.

What if I don’t want to flip it? You can finish the omelette under a broiler for a few minutes instead of flipping, though it may affect the texture slightly.

What’s the best pan size? For a thick omelette, use an 8–9.5 inch pan; for a thinner one, use a larger pan.

Can I add other ingredients? Yes! Try adding cooked chorizo, herbs, or cheese for a twist.


Leave a Reply

Your email address will not be published. Required fields are marked *

Recipe Rating